| Staff | I do not have a AdSense account, but from what i have seen posted on other websites, Google might have a problem with what your doing here and could possibly ban you. Have you looked into this? I seem to think you might be encouraging members of idomainsite to click on ads. I dont know but if I was webmaster of idomainsite I would do more research on this topic. |

| Administrator | It's perfectly fine and the Adsense Team don't have a problem with this. There is no incentive to click because if you click an Ad you won't benefit from it at all. While you are logged in your Adsense code will never be displayed to you, so there is no way you can artificially inflate your earnings. Also your Ads are only displayed on the threads you participate on, therefor you have contributed content to the page and are not benefiting from work created by someone else. The first major site to implement this type of system started doing it in 2004, they have an Alexa rank in the 100's and generate over $10,000 per month in Adsense revenue. The owner has been featured in places like Wired Magazine, TheAge, Time Magazine etc regarding this and the feature is still running strong today and being used by tens of thousands of users. So i can assure you it's 100% allowed, and in no way a risk to your publishers account.
